Lines Matching refs:mem
38 * This enumerator creates mem-schemed nodes for each dimm found in the
45 #define PLATFORM_MEM_NAME "platform-mem"
47 #define MEM_NODE_NAME "mem"
88 md_mem_info_t *mem;
95 if ((mem = topo_mod_zalloc(mod, sizeof (md_mem_info_t))) == NULL)
98 if (mem_mdesc_init(mod, mem) != 0) {
100 topo_mod_free(mod, mem, sizeof (md_mem_info_t));
104 topo_mod_setspecific(mod, (void *)mem);
109 mem_mdesc_fini(mod, mem);
110 topo_mod_free(mod, mem, sizeof (md_mem_info_t));
122 md_mem_info_t *mem;
124 mem = (md_mem_info_t *)topo_mod_getspecific(mod);
126 mem_mdesc_fini(mod, mem);
128 topo_mod_free(mod, mem, sizeof (md_mem_info_t));
143 md_mem_info_t *mem = (md_mem_info_t *)topo_mod_getspecific(mod);
156 if (mem_get_dimm_by_sn(nvlserids[n], mem) != NULL) {
182 md_mem_info_t *mem = (md_mem_info_t *)topo_mod_getspecific(mod);
195 if (mem_get_dimm_by_sn(nvlserids[n], mem) != NULL) {
303 md_mem_info_t *mem = (md_mem_info_t *)topo_mod_getspecific(mod);
317 for (seg = mem->mem_seg; seg != NULL; seg = seg->sm_next) {
327 for (seg = mem->mem_seg; seg != NULL; seg = seg->sm_next) {
347 * The sun4v mem: scheme expand() now assumes that the FMRI -has- serial
478 * the original mem FMRI with the specified offset or PA.
636 md_mem_info_t *mem)
650 for (mp = mem->mem_dm; mp != NULL; mp = mp->dm_next) {
665 for (mp = mem->mem_dm, i = 0; mp != NULL; mp = mp->dm_next, i++) {